On the Fluctuations of the Stochastic Traveling Salesperson Problem

Consider n points X1, …, Xn independently and uniformly distributed on the unit square [0, 1]2. Denote by Tn the length of the shortest tour through X1, …, Xn. We prove that for some universal constant K, we have P(|TnE(Tn)| ≥ t) ≥ K−1 exp(−t2K) whenever tK−1n1/2.
